RFP Description

The Vendor is required to provide billing services for the county's emergency medical services department.
- Billing
• Commence billing the patient care reports upon the date in the notice to proceed issued by the county procurement services division.
• Assign and identify a dedicated client representative to the county ems account.
• All billers dedicated to the agency account shall maintain certification through the ambulance coders.
• Also bill all non-emergency transports according to all applicable laws established by medicare, medicaid and other applicable agencies.
• All invoices shall also be billed in compliance with fair debt collection practices act.
• Electronic filing is the required method of filing primary medicare and medicaid claims and is the preferred method of filing to all guarantors, if applicable; otherwise, paper invoices may be issued directly to appropriate patient guarantors.
• Pre-screen all claims to confirm compliance with guarantor's guidelines. (I.e. physician certification statements, assignment of benefit signature forms, medical necessity documentation)
• Verify insurance eligibility utilizing available resources and commercial databases prior to the submission of any patient claim for reimbursement.
• Make a good-faith attempt to call each patient when verification of insurance eligibility cannot be obtained by any other manner to ensure accurate guarantor responsibility information.
• The expectation of the county is that the processing of claims will be processed within three (3) business days of the electronic posting of the billing file on the firm's secure server, according to the agreed upon process for various claim types.
- Collections
• Process all claims according to timelines agreed upon between the county and the firm; the claims shall be divided into multiple revenue categories: medicare, medicaid, private insurance and private pay.
• Claims shall be appropriately re-categorized after receiving payment from the primary guarantor; all denials shall be processed according to the timeline defined by the firm and the county.
